Transaction d81dbebb3cee6a6aadd3261cf141172fad39a8379c8a345be77334d07d2a777e
1 Input
1 Output
-
d81dbebb3cee6a6aadd3261cf141172fad39a8379c8a345be77334d07d2a777e:0
- value
- 141970
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d846a5914770762da7399cc7c5709fadebaa3481 OP_EQUAL
- address
- 3MQaWbpoAxfGd1fjLvUzR1LRGacquH9HdA